Preparing the glass for reglazing

Depending on the type of glass, you will need to use glazing compound to help keep the glass in place. You can use either an oil-based primer or latex paint. If you decide to go with an oil-based primer, make sure it's a top quality brand.

You should utilize a drop cloth, or another protective material to stop any paint from chipping. It is also recommended to wear gloves. To smooth the glaze, you can use putty knife.


Clean the frame of dust and debris after taking off the old glazing. Apply an oil-based exterior primer. Make sure to leave at a minimum one sixteenth inch of room for the glass to fit. This clearance will allow the glazier's points the glazier to hold the glass.

After the primer has dried, you can add glazing beads to your glass. The beads must be cut with a knife blade on either side of the mullion. When the new glazing is installed, it might stick to the glass along the edges of the bead.

After trimming the bead, apply silicone caulk to the glass. The silicone should be placed at least five to six inches away from the corners. To complete the job you can also use a caulk gun. After applying the caulk, you can moisten the finger and use it for smoothing the caulk.

Removal of a sash to replace glass

If you're looking to replace the glass in a window or repair a broken sash and you want to do it, first you have to take off the sash. This is not always an easy task. It may involve working with sharp tools, and there are some hazards to be aware of. To ensure your safety be sure to wear protective clothing and wear a protective mask if you don't own one.

Measure the width and height your window's opening. You should take measurements at the top, middle and the bottom of the opening. This information will help you decide on the right sash.

If you have an glass sash with an insulation you may have to remove the counterweighted , springs that hold the glass in position. The gasket that covers the glass's edges must also be removed. It can be difficult to find however, you can replace it with a gasket that has been molded. It could be made from vinyl or neoprene.

Then, you need to remove the upper sash. To remove the parting stopper, you may require either a chisel or pry bar. Parting stops are usually made of wood and are drilled into the frame. If they are not then you can fill them in with wood filler.

The lower sash needs to be removed after that. To do this, tilt the sash to one side or the other and raise it up. Be careful not to break any glass.

Removing a broken window

You can remove broken windows with the proper tools and materials. Wearing the proper protective clothing, such as safety glasses and thick gloves, as well as long sleeves is a must. You can also cover the glass's perimeter with an cloth. This will prevent glass fragments from flying away.

The first step is to remove any putty holding the glass. This can be accomplished using the use of a heating gun. This will to soften the adhesive. To cut the putty off you may also use a jackknife.

Once the old putty is removed, you can begin removing the broken glass. Certain windows are held in place by triangular nail fasteners which are typically two or three on each side of the pane. They can be difficult to pull out, so you may have to resort to using a knife.

After you have removed the glass, you are able to replace it. You'll need to choose the correct replacement glass and take the proper measurements. This can be accomplished by home improvement centers. You may also need to remove the frame.

To keep the pane together To keep the pane together, you'll need to apply painter's tape. Be careful not to press too hard against the glass, as this could cause damage to the glass. Masking tape should be used for both the outside and interior. This will prevent the glass from flying away and landing in the wrong spot.
